Fog Computing: The Future of AI Deployment

As artificial intelligence (AI) transforms, the need for powerful deployment methods becomes increasingly critical. Enter edge computing, a paradigm shift that brings analysis closer to the source. By distributing AI workloads across a network of devices at the application's edge, edge computing enables several key benefits for AI deployment. Firstly, it minimizes latency, offering real-time insights and responses crucial for applications like autonomous vehicles and industrial automation. Secondly, edge computing enhances data security by keeping sensitive information localized and reducing the reliance on centralized servers. Building Intelligent Systems at the Network Perimeter

The evolution of intelligent systems is rapidly shifting from centralized cloud deployments to distributed architectures at the network's edge. This paradigm shift, driven by the demand for low latency, enhanced security, and reduced bandwidth consumption, enables instantaneous data processing and decision-making closer to the source. Edge computing empowers a new generation of intelligent systems that can analyze data locally, reacting swiftly to changing conditions and delivering innovative applications across various industries.

  • One compelling example is in the realm of autonomous driving, where edge computing allows for real-time object detection and path planning, optimizing safety and efficiency.
  • Furthermore, in industrial automation, edge intelligence enables foresight repairs, reducing downtime and boosting overall productivity.
